## 4.2.0 — Changed defaults

Heads up for review: Snapglass snapshot testing now masks dynamic tokens (timestamps, session nonces) by default before writing fixtures, so secrets shouldn't land in committed snapshots anymore. We also flipped `failOnNewSnapshot` to true in CI, meaning unreviewed UI changes can't sneak in silently. Obsolete snapshots get pruned automatically rather than lingering in the repo. Worth eyeballing from a data-leakage angle. The defaults shipping with this release are listed below.

settings of tagef-bawif:
DRUIX_HOST=druix.zemvarlabs.internal
DRUIX_PORT=8000

Quarterly Planning Note — Divestiture of the Coastal Tooling Unit

For the finance team: the sale of the Coastal Tooling unit to Pellmark Industries remains on track for close in Q3. Please finalize the carve-out balance sheet, reconcile intercompany positions, and prepare the working-capital adjustment schedule by month-end. Audit support requests should be prioritized. For planning purposes, note the following sensitive item:

internal memo for hawef-kahif: The finance team signed off on a budget of $25.9 million for Project Sorox. The renewal with Pelokek Logistics closes at $51.7 million a year, 52 percent below the last contract.

## Deploying the Gatewick Proctor Queue

Deploys are pretty painless: push to main, wait for the pipeline, then watch the queue drain dashboard for five minutes. If candidates pile up mid-exam, roll back first and ask questions later — the queue replays safely. Everything the workers care about lives in one config block, shown here for reference.

settings of bafof-yagef:
JOROX_PIN=8740
JOROX_TENANT=pelox
JOROX_METRICS_HOST=metrics.jorox.qorvelworks.internal
JOROX_SEAL=seal_c78f63c1
JOROX_STANDBY_TEAM=norax

## Alert: StatRelay Sidecar Flush Lag

This alert fires when the StatRelay metrics-aggregation sidecar falls more than 120 seconds behind on flushing buffered samples to the Coalmine backend. Plugin-emitted counters are buffered in-process, so sustained lag usually means a plugin is emitting unbounded label cardinality or blocking the flush thread. Check your plugin's metric registration against the published cardinality limits before escalating. If the lag persists after your plugin is ruled out, contact the telemetry team.

escalation mailbox, bagug-fahof: novdor.wendor.jormir@norvalabs.example